The meeting of the British royal family and the Obamas marked a significant moment in modern diplomacy. Queen Elizabeth II and President Barack Obama, two towering figures in their respective countries, first met in 2009, bridging the gap between tradition and modernity. The relationship grew over the years, with Michelle Obama developing a close friendship with the Queen, highlighted by their famous embrace during the Obamas' 2011 state visit. The connection between the Windsors and the Obamas went beyond politics, rooted in mutual respect and shared values. The friendship showcased how global diplomacy and personal connections can create powerful, lasting ties between two very different families.
